Goffstown, New Hampshire — Key Historical Facts
- Goffstown was settled in the 1730s and was incorporated as a town in 1761.
- The town was named after John Goffe, an early settler and military figure in New Hampshire history.
- Goffstown developed around farming, milling, and water-powered industries along the Piscataquog River.
- The arrival of rail transportation in the nineteenth century helped connect Goffstown with nearby Manchester and regional markets.
- Today, Goffstown is known for its historic village areas, outdoor recreation, mountain landscapes, and small-town character near Manchester.
